ERC-20 tokens are fungible digital assets that exist on the Ethereum blockchain. This technical standard enables smart contract development and allows developers to create and deploy tokens within Ethereum. The ERC-20 standard is a precise set of rules that developers must follow to ensure token compatibility. It provides both users and developers with the ability to participate in any service, application, or protocol on the Ethereum network.
Fabian Vogelsteller introduced the ERC-20 token standard. He submitted his proposal on Ethereum’s GitHub as an "Ethereum Request Comment," designated "20" because it was the twentieth comment on the page. After the Ethereum developer community approved it, Vogelsteller’s proposal was implemented as 'Ethereum Improvement Proposal (EIP-20)', though the standard is widely known as ERC-20.
The ERC-20 standard is built for smart contracts, which automatically execute predefined agreements once specific conditions are met. Powered by the Ethereum Virtual Machine (EVM), smart contracts operate much like vending machines, carrying out designated actions when requirements are satisfied. This is the mechanism behind ERC-20 tokens.

While ERC-20 is the most recognized token standard, others include ERC-165, ERC-621, ERC-777, ERC-721 (for NFTs), ERC-223, and ERC-1155.

No, ERC-20 and ETH serve different purposes. ERC-20 is a token standard on Ethereum, while ETH is Ethereum’s native cryptocurrency.
